Rotation Request Form Desired Rotation InformationType of Student*Please Choose...Medical StudentPA StudentNP StudentCHM StudentGeneral Surgery for GVSU PAs onlyDesired Rotation*Choose a Rotation...Emergency MedicineFamily MedicineInternal MedicineGeneral SurgeryOBOrthopedicsUrologyDesired Rotation*Choose a Rotation...Internal MedicinePediatricsPrior to consideration for residency training in our program, the following 3 items must be completed: 1. The non-osteopathic graduate applicant must include in their application personal statement an explanation as to why he/she is applying to be a resident in an OB/GYN osteopathic recognition program. 2. The non-osteopathic graduates must demonstrate a background in osteopathic philosophy and practices. They will be required to complete a course on introduction to osteopathic medicine. The web-based course through Rowan University "Introduction to Osteopathic Medicine",(https://learn.canvas.net/courses/925) will fulfill this requirement. (16 hours). There is no charge for this course. 3. The non-osteopathic resident will participate in the MSU-COM-SCS "OPP and MD Workshop" Series. Each two-day workshop has specific educational outcome measures that will assist the resident in applying OPP into the OR (Osteopathic Recognition) residency. - "OPP and the MD Workshop #1 will be offered (at MSU-COM) prior to the start of the PGY-1 year. - "OPP and the MD Workshop #2 is offered just before the start of the PGY-2 year. The intent of these workshops is to prepare the non-DO with basic terminology and assessment skills to be further developed and refined during their first and second PGY year of the OR residency program and beyond.. As an Osteopathically-focused program, we likewise will only consider audition applicants who demonstrate an interest in this area and are willing/able to meet the criteria noted above. A minimum COMLEX score of 600 or a minimum USMLE score of 230 is required by the program director in order for an individual to do an audition rotation (you do not need both to apply).Thank you for your interest in the Osteopathic Neuromusculoskeletal Medicine Residency (ONMM) Program at Metro Health – University of Michigan Health. Under the ACGME, we are striving to continue a FM/NMM program as closely as possible. Our residents stay in our Family Medicine program with what we currently call the Integrated Track to ONMM. Although on paper, they will be completing an ONMM-3 as a PGY 4, the designated FM resident will be actively engaged with ONMM clinic, didactics, and hospital consults throughout all 4 years.
